Science is a systematic enterprise that builds and organizes knowledge in the form of testable explanations and predictions about the universe. It involves the observation of natural phenomena, experimentation, and the formulation of theories to understand and explain the workings of the physical and natural world.
Science is crucial for advancing human understanding, solving problems, and making informed decisions. It drives technological innovations, contributes to medical breakthroughs, and addresses environmental challenges. Science provides the foundation for evidence-based decision-making in various fields.
Main branches include physical sciences (physics and chemistry), life sciences (biology), earth sciences (geology), and social sciences (psychology, sociology). Each branch focuses on specific aspects of the natural world and human behavior.
The scientific method involves making observations, formulating a hypothesis, conducting experiments, collecting data, and analyzing results. The process is iterative, with the goal of refining and improving our understanding of natural phenomena through evidence-based reasoning.
Technology has greatly accelerated scientific progress by providing advanced tools for observation, experimentation, and data analysis. Technologies such as microscopes, telescopes, and computational models have revolutionized scientific research across various disciplines.
